This market will resolve according to the result of the season series between the Atlanta Falcons and Carolina Panthers during the 2026-27 NFL regular season. If the Atlanta Falcons win the season series, this market will resolve to “Falcons”. If the Carolina Panthers win the season series, this market will resolve to “Panthers”. If the Atlanta Falcons and Carolina Panthers tie the season series, this market will resolve to “tie”. If any scheduled game between the listed teams during the 2026-27 NFL regular season is cancelled, not completed, or otherwise does not produce an official result — including due to a shortened, truncated, or early-ended season — the season series will be determined solely using official results of completed games. If the season is cancelled, no games between the teams are completed, or the result of the season series cannot otherwise be confirmed by January 26, 2027, 11:59 PM ET, this market will resolve 50-50. The primary resolution source for this market will be information from the NFL, however a consensus of credible reporting will also be used.Both the Atlanta Falcons and Carolina Panthers enter the 2026 season with significant roster and coaching turnover in a weak NFC South, making a split of their two regular-season meetings the market’s leading outcome. The Falcons are adjusting to new head coach Kevin Stefanski, a crowded and injury-plagued quarterback room featuring Tua Tagovailoa and Michael Penix Jr., and defensive questions, leaving them with low projected win totals around 6–7. The Panthers, the 2025 division winners at 8–9, retain continuity under Dave Canales and Bryce Young but face offensive-line uncertainty and key defensive injuries from training camp. With both clubs viewed as middling and evenly matched on paper, traders see limited edge for either side to claim the season series outright, especially given typical divisional-game variance and the late-season Week 18 matchup.
